
Size: Firbolgs are on the upper limit of medium size, being 7-8ft tall, 300lbs.įirbolg Magic: Detect Magic and Disguise Self, especially the buffed version of Disguise Self are great utility spells to have in your pocket. WIS casters like Druids and Clerics find the +2 WIS bonus hard to come by, so they are going to love this class even if the STR bonus isn’t necessarily something they are looking for.Īge: Firbolg reach adulthood at a similar age as humans (30) and the oldest among them can live up to 500.Īlignment: Neutral Good is a lot easier to fit into a character than stricter alignments. Rangers and Monks typically go for DEX alongside their WIS, whereas the STR based semi-casters like Eldritch Knight and Paladin using INT and CHA respectively. Firbolg TraitsĪbility Score Increase: A +2 to WIS and +1 to STR certainly isn’t a stat most classes are looking for.
